### Problem
`Column::remainder().clip(true)` grows correctly when the panel is made
wider, but does not shrink when the panel is made narrower.
### Root cause
There are two places in `table.rs` where the `max_used_widths` floor is
applied to column widths. One correctly checks `column.clip`, the other
doesn't.
**Post-render** path (already correct, line ~827):
```rust
if !column.clip {
*column_width = column_width.at_least(max_used_widths[i]);
}
```
`TableState::load` **pre-render path** (the bug, line 647):
```rust
.at_least(column.width_range.min.max(*max_used)) // clip flag ignored
```
In `TableState::load`, `.at_least(max_used)` is applied to every column
regardless of `clip`. For a `Column::remainder()`, `max_used`
accumulates the historically widest rendered content. When the panel
shrinks, this floor prevents the column from computing a smaller width,
creating a cycle where it can never shrink.
### Fix
Apply the same `clip` guard that already exists in the post-render path:
```rust
.at_least(if column.clip {
column.width_range.min
} else {
column.width_range.min.max(*max_used)
})
```
When `clip = true`, the floor is just `width_range.min` (0.0 by
default), allowing the remainder column to shrink freely to the actual
remaining space.

## What
Two new builder methods on `DatePickerButton`:
- **`reverse_years(bool)`** — lists years in descending order (newest
first). Useful when users are more likely to pick recent years.
- **`year_scroll_to(i32)`** — scrolls the year dropdown to a specific
year when it first opens, centred in the list. Defaults to the currently
selected year, so the picker no longer opens at the top of a 110-item
list.
## Why
The year `ComboBox` currently always renders in ascending order and
opens scrolled to the top. For a range spanning e.g. 1925–2035, the
current year is buried near the bottom. Users have to scroll past ~100
entries every time they open the picker.
## Notes
- Both options are purely additive builder methods — no breaking
changes.
- `year_scroll_needed` is a persisted state flag that is set on popup
open and cleared after the first scroll, so the user can freely scroll
the list after that.
- Existing behaviour is unchanged when neither method is called.

This PR adds support for syntax highlighting with custom
`syntect::parsing::SyntaxSet` and `syntect::highlighting::ThemeSet`. It
adds a new `egui_extras::highlight_with` function (enabled with `feature
= "syntect"`), which takes a new public`struct SyntectSettings`
containing the syntax and theme sets.
```rust
let mut builder = SyntaxSetBuilder::new();
builder.add_from_folder("syntax", true).unwrap();
let ps = builder.build();
let ts = syntect::highlighting::ThemeSet::load_defaults();
let syntax =
egui_extras::syntax_highlighting::SyntectSettings { ps, ts };
// ...elsewhere
egui_extras::syntax_highlighting::highlight_with(
ui.ctx(),
ui.style(),
&theme,
buf,
"rhai",
&syntax,
);
```
There's a little bit of architectural complexity, but it all emerges
naturally from the problem's constraints.
Previously, the `Highlighter` both contained the `syntect` settings
_and_ implemented `egui::cache::ComputerMut` to highlight a string; the
settings would never change. After this change, the `syntect` settings
have become part of the cache key, so we should redo highlighting if
they change. The `Highlighter` becomes an empty `struct` which just
serves to implement `ComputerMut`.
`SyntaxSet` and `ThemeSet` are not hasheable themselves, so can't be
used as cache keys direction. Instead, we can use the *address* of the
`&SyntectSettings` as the key. This requires an object with a custom
`Hash` implementation, so I added a new `HighlightSettings(&'a
SyntectSettings)`, implementing `Hash` using `std::ptr::hash` on the
reference. I think using the address is reasonable – it would be _weird_
for a user to be constantly moving around their `SyntectSettings`, and
there's a warning in the docstring to this effect.
To work _without_ custom settings, `SyntectSettings::default` preserves
the same behavior as before, using `SyntaxSet::load_defaults_newlines`
and `ThemeSet::load_defaults`. If the user doesn't provide custom
settings, then we instantiate a singleton `SyntectSettings` in `data`
and use it; this will only be constructed once.
Finally, in cases where the `syntect` feature is disabled,
`SyntectSettings` are replaced with a unit `()`. This adds a _tiny_
amount of overhead – one singleton `Arc<()>` allocation and a lookup in
`data` per `highlight` – but I think that's better than dramatically
different implementations. If this is an issue, I can refactor to make
it zero-cost when the feature is disabled.

Today each widget does its own custom layout, which has some drawbacks:
- not very flexible
- you can add an `Image` to `Button` but it will always be shown on the
left side
- you can't add a `Image` to a e.g. a `SelectableLabel`
- a lot of duplicated code
This PR introduces `Atoms` and `AtomLayout` which abstracts over "widget
content" and layout within widgets, so it'd be possible to add images /
text / custom rendering (for e.g. the checkbox) to any widget.
A simple custom button implementation is now as easy as this:
```rs
pub struct ALButton<'a> {
al: AtomicLayout<'a>,
}
impl<'a> ALButton<'a> {
pub fn new(content: impl IntoAtomics) -> Self {
Self { al: content.into_atomics() }
}
}
impl<'a> Widget for ALButton<'a> {
fn ui(mut self, ui: &mut Ui) -> Response {
let response = ui.ctx().read_response(ui.next_auto_id());
let visuals = response.map_or(&ui.style().visuals.widgets.inactive, |response| {
ui.style().interact(&response)
});
self.al.frame = self
.al
.frame
.inner_margin(ui.style().spacing.button_padding)
.fill(visuals.bg_fill)
.stroke(visuals.bg_stroke)
.corner_radius(visuals.corner_radius);
self.al.show(ui)
}
}
```
The initial implementation only does very basic layout, just enough to
be able to implement most current egui widgets, so:
- only horizontal layout
- everything is centered
- a single item may grow/shrink based on the available space
- everything can be contained in a Frame
There is a trait `IntoAtoms` that conveniently allows you to construct
`Atoms` from a tuple
```
ui.button((Image::new("image.png"), "Click me!"))
```
to get a button with image and text.

This fixes bugs related to how an `Image` follows the size of an SVG.
We track the "source size" of each image, i.e. the original width/height
of the SVG, which can be different from whatever it was rasterized as.
* Closes https://github.com/emilk/egui/issues/3501
The problem occurs when you want to render the same SVG at different
scales, either at the same time in different parts of your UI, or at two
different times (e.g. the DPI changes).
The solution is to use the `SizeHint` as part of the key.
However, when you have an SVG in a resizable container, that can lead to
hundreds of versions of the same SVG. So new eviction code is added to
handle this case.
With kittest it was difficult to wait for images to be loaded before
taking a snapshot test.
This PR adds `Harness::with_wait_for_pending_images` (true by default)
which will cause `Harness::run` to sleep until all images are loaded (or
`HarnessBuilder::with_max_steps` is exceeded).
It also adds a new ImageLoader::has_pending and
BytesLoader::has_pending, which should be implemented if things are
loaded / decoded asynchronously.
